    Off the beaten track and a cool view

    Scary drive to get there, but it a great way to do something other than the beach. Nice view from the top, highest point in the BVI

    A little patch of Rain forest

    The hike is a moderate well marked hike on the highest point on Tortola, amazing views, plant life and multiple bird species. Great way to spend the morning.
